IX. MAINTENANCE AND SERVICE
WARNINGS:
Technical repairs should be performed by qualified personnel, trained either by
BIO-MED DEVICES, INC or their authorized trainers. Bio-Med Devices, Inc. is not
responsible for unauthorized repairs, or repairs made by unauthorized procedures.
The CROSSVENT should pass a full technical performance check after any repair
procedure that requires the case to be opened.
All safety measures must be observed when servicing this device. In particular, the
ventilator must be turned off and the power supply disconnected.
Because this is a CE marked device, it must never be modified without prior
expressed written consent from Bio-Med Devices.

The following is an overview of the SETUP and CALIBRATION (CAL) menus. Some functions in these
menus will be used in the performance checks that follow this overview and will be further explained there.
To activate the SETUP and CALIBRATION menus, turn the ON/OFF switch to ON and press the SETUP
key on the main menu. This key is only present immediately after power-on. It is removed and replaced by
the ARROW keys by pressing any key with the exception of the ALARM QUIET or BATTERY key. When
pressing the SETUP key, the SETUP menu is displayed. It is possible to go to the CALIBRATION menu by
pressing the CAL MENU key or to return to normal operation at any time by pressing the MAIN MENU
key.

OXYGEN SENSOR CALIBRATION (if sensor is used)
This function is used to calibrate the Oxygen sensor cell.
NOTE: It is important to use the correct reference gases (100 and 21%) when performing this calibration. A
worn out sensor will not calibrate accurately.
NOTE: Due to the fact that O2 sensors sometimes change output over time once exposed to atmosphere, a
calibration should be performed once a month in order to assure optimal accuracy. When the sensor is consumed
and does not calibrate properly, it should be discarded and a new sensor installed and calibrated.

Allows the user to choose between Inspiratory Time and Tidal Volume as it is displayed in the menus.
When INSP TIME is pressed and the SETUP menu is exited, INSP (inspiratory) will be displayed below the
RATE key in the MAIN menu, thereby allowing the user to set an inspiratory time directly. If tidal volume
would rather be set, then press TIDAL VOLUME in the SETUP menu and exit. Whichever is chosen will
remain in effect until it is changed in this menu.
